Transaction 94343e147311d1a73651a512746091b4397b9441ee40efda484faaff755e4fed
2 Input
2 Outputs
- 94343e147311d1a73651a512746091b4397b9441ee40efda484faaff755e4fed:0
- 94343e147311d1a73651a512746091b4397b9441ee40efda484faaff755e4fed:1
value 433998
address 1C1a2EvscQm4x6fepBFDkT3PH5L8SDZbsk
value 1273793
address 1G1WWdWLr7CgmCtTYEYvkesn1zEBmk9aJn